Asmara
az-MAH-rah
Asmara is a girl’s name of African origin, meaning “The capital city of Eritrea, meaning 'they united' in Tigrinya.”. It currently ranks #8477 in the US, and peaked in popularity in 2018.

Asmara is a name with a strong geographical and historical resonance, taken from the capital city of Eritrea. In the Tigrinya language, the name means 'they united,' symbolizing harmony and a gathering of people.
